SignalFx Resource Provider

The SignalFx resource provider for Pulumi lets you manage SignalFx resources in your cloud programs. To use this package, please install the Pulumi CLI first.

Installing

This package is available in many languages in the standard packaging formats.

Node.js (Java/TypeScript)

To use from JavaScript or TypeScript in Node.js, install using either npm:

$ npm install @pulumi/signalfx

or yarn:

$ yarn add @pulumi/signalfx

Python

To use from Python, install using pip:

$ pip install pulumi_signalfx

Go

To use from Go, use go get to grab the latest version of the library

$ go get github.com/pulumi/pulumi-signalfx/sdk/v7

.NET

To use from .NET, install using dotnet add package:

$ dotnet add package Pulumi.Signalfx

Configuration

The following configuration points are available:

  • signalfx:authToken - (Required) The auth token for authentication. This can also be set via the SFX_AUTH_TOKEN environment variable.
  • signalfx:apiUrl - (Optional) The API URL to use for communicating with SignalFx. This is helpful for organizations who need to set their Realm or use a proxy. Note: You likely want to change customAppUrl too!
  • signalfx:customAppUrl - (Optional) The application URL that users should use to interact with assets in the browser. This is used by organizations using specific realms or those with a custom SSO domain.
